#!/bin/bash
# selector-development-pipeline-stepper.sh — 8-step pipeline state machine
#
# Hook    : PreToolUse:Bash|Edit|Write  — deny if predecessor step not in journal as pass
#           PostToolUse:Bash|Edit|Write — append step entry to journal on success or fail
# Mode    : DENY (Pre) + RECORD (Post)
# State   : <ws>/tests/e2e/.selector-development/<scope>.receipt.json
# Env     : WORKSPACE_ROOT (required) — filesystem root of the target project
#           FAKE_STAGED_HASH — override for staged diff hash (test mode)
#
# Pipeline steps (ordered):
#   1. before_snapshot  — playwright-cli screenshot .../before/...
#   2. patch_applied    — Edit|Write to frontend source path
#   3. typecheck        — npm run typecheck / tsc --noEmit / npx tsc
#   4. unit_tests       — npm test / npm run test / vitest / jest (not playwright)
#   5. e2e              — playwright test
#   6. after_snapshot   — playwright-cli screenshot .../after/...
#   7. visual_diff      — node .../visual-diff.js
#   8. commit           — git commit (extra: git_diff_hash must match staged diff)
#
# Behaviour:
#   PreToolUse
#     - Silent allow if tool isn't Bash|Edit|Write
#     - Silent allow if no .current-scope or no receipt (scope not in flight)
#     - Silent allow if step is unrecognised
#     - Deny if any step in journal has status=fail (must revert and restart)
#     - Deny if this step's predecessor isn't in journal with status=pass
#     - Step 1 (before_snapshot) has no predecessor — allow if receipt exists
#     - Step 8 (commit) additionally requires git_diff_hash match
#   PostToolUse
#     - Silent allow regardless (records; never blocks)
#     - Appends {name, status: pass|fail, ts} to journal
#     - commit on pass: archives receipt + clears .current-scope
#
# Canonical reference
# -------------------
# skills/selector-development/SKILL.md §"Pipeline steps"
